We are in search of two Systems Engineers for our Leidos engineering capability. Using your experience in Systems Engineering, you will be responsible for working with customers and suppliers to execute Systems Engineering activities across the full lifecycle, with a focus on the low-level system design.

Your role and responsibilities:

  • Maintain Requirements Verification Traceability Matrix (RVTM).
  • Update artefacts (designs and documents) so that they map to RVTM.
  • Work with Testers to Review Requirements against Test cases/acceptance criteria, identify gaps, propose solutions and manage exceptions/mitigations.
  • Define and update acceptance criteria and get agreement from customer/stakeholders.
  • Support the definition and design of interfaces.
  • Version control all relevant SE artefacts and agreed interfaces.
  • Document and manage programme V Model activities and Artefacts while liaising with delivery team leads.
  •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to ensure seamless integration of hardware, software, and network components.
  • Document data flow and data matrix views of a system.
  • Contribute to Systems Concept of Operations Document through process definition and documentation.
  • Track and present progress of deliverables and dependencies.
  • Review and Update Systems Engineering Management Plan (SEMP) when needed.
  • Document engineering management/governance processes.

Basic Qualifications:

  • Proven track record with a minimum of 3 years’ experience in Systems Engineering role for IT/software systems.
  • Familiarity in working within at least Systems Engineering Frameworks e.g., ICOSE, NAF, DODAF, MODAF, MBSE.
  • Good working knowledge of Software and Hardware used for IT systems technologies.
  • Experience of Systems Engineering within a Software/IT delivery.
  • Experience of working within Agile and Waterfall delivery models.
  • Excellent analytical, organisational, and communication skills.
  • Self-Starter with ability to work with minimal supervision.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ree or suitable experience in an Engineering or Technology subject.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age multiple priorities and work effectively in cross-functional teams.
  • Ideally proficient with system modelling tools (e.g., SysML, UML) and enterprise design software/system modelling (e.g., Cameo, Archimate).

Security Clearance / Other:

  • Ability to gain Metropolitan Police Service NPPV2 security clearance (essential).
  • Willingness to gain MOD DV (advantageous).
  • Work can be done from Home Location.
  • Expected to be in the Farnborough office 2 days per fortnight.
  • Expected to attend Programme Increment planning 5 Days every 3 months in Leidos Office (Farnborough/Glasgow) and be able to attend customer location (Greater London) when needed; typically 2 days per month.
